Loaded Tater Tots: A Chicken and Bacon Delight
These loaded tater tots are a crispy, cheesy appetizer that features a mouthwatering blend of flavors. The combination of tender chicken, crispy bacon, and gooey cheese creates a satisfying dish that’s perfect for game days or gatherings.
Ingredients
- 1 lb frozen tater tots
- 1 cup cooked chicken, shredded
- 4 slices bacon, cooked and crumbled
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- 2 green onions, chopped
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ven according to the tater tots package instructions.
- Bake Tater Tots: Spread the frozen tater tots on a baking sheet and bake them until crispy and golden, following the package instructions.
- Prepare Chicken Mixture: While the tater tots are baking, combine the shredded chicken, crumbled bacon, garlic powder, salt, and pepper in a bowl.
- Layer the Tater Tots: Once baked, remove the tater tots from the oven and sprinkle the chicken mixture evenly over the top.
- Add Cheese: Generously top the chicken and tater tots with shredded cheddar cheese.
- Melt and Serve: Return to the oven and bake until the cheese is melted and bubbly, about 5-7 minutes. Drizzle with sour cream and garnish with chopped green onions before serving.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
